Exploring Hexagonal Terracotta Tile Varieties

Hexagonal terracotta tile serves as a versatile and timeless flooring option, bringing warmth and character to various settings. These tiles, known for their six-sided shape, infuse spaces with a rustic charm that is both durable and aesthetically pleasing. From terracotta hexagon floor tile to wall applications, this category encompasses a range of styles suitable for numerous environments.

The Composition and Durability of Terracotta Tiles

Terracotta, literally "baked earth," is a natural material that has been used for centuries. The making of hexagon tile terracotta involves shaping, drying, and firing natural clay, which results in a hard, sturdy tile. These tiles are known for their longevity and ability to retain their earthy color over time. The durability of terracotta floor tile hexagon makes it an ideal choice for high-traffic areas, offering a balance between practicality and style.

Design Flexibility with Hexagonal Terracotta

The unique hexagonal shape of these tiles allows for creative installation patterns, making terracotta hex tile a favorite among designers. Whether it's for a terracotta hexagon tiles bathroom or a hexagon terracotta tile kitchen, the natural hues and geometric patterns can complement various design themes, from traditional to contemporary.

Applications and Settings

While commonly used for flooring, terra cotta hexagon tile is also suitable for wall cladding, offering a distinctive look in showers and backsplashes. The adaptability of hexagon terracotta extends to outdoor spaces as well, where they serve as robust options for patios, walkways, and even as decorative accents in garden designs.

Environmental Benefits and Aesthetic Appeal

Hexagonal quarry tiles are not only visually appealing but also environmentally friendly, as terracotta is a sustainable material. The insulating properties of hexagon clay tile contribute to energy efficiency in homes, maintaining a cool feel underfoot during warmer months and warmth during cooler periods.

Choosing the Right Terracotta Tile

When selecting hexagon terracotta flooring, it's essential to consider the space's specific needs. For instance, reclaimed hexagonal terracotta tiles can add an element of history and uniqueness to a space. In contrast, new porcelain hexagon tile terracotta options might offer a more uniform look for a modern setting.
